Output 91dac939f63686895bbd81c8dfb31f41bcfa57a1b4e0b61b765b8e5bdc3873a7:24

value
105280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950ece9ebdc3c310bc514c572440bae00fa42e0c OP_EQUAL
address
3FHALwcqcoAyh1nTDmNNNe6UykdHbgiJZQ
transaction
91dac939f63686895bbd81c8dfb31f41bcfa57a1b4e0b61b765b8e5bdc3873a7
confirmations
242598
spent
true